How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Benwood?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Benwood Studio Apartments | $1,097 | $442 | $1,660 |
Benwood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,609 | $400 | $2,736 |
Benwood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,963 | $502 | $4,231 |
Benwood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,034 | $925 | $3,985 |
Benwood 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,537 | $1,405 | $1,670 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Benwood
How much are Studio apartments in Benwood?
There are currently 6 Studio Apartments in Benwood with rent ranges from $442 to $1,660 with an average price of $1,097.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Benwood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Benwood ranges from $400 to $2,736 with an average monthly rent of $1,609.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Benwood c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Benwood range from $502 to $4,231.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,963.
How expensive are Benwood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 20 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Benwood on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$925 to $3,985 - averaging $2,034 for the location.
